Storm Garfish Season Starting
Submitted by Mick C on Sun, 2017-07-02 11:40It is the time of year when storm garfish are starting to become available at market. The numbers are fairly low now (Friday's image below), but should increase in the coming months.

Based on previous experience, demand for big storm gardies significantly exceeds supply. They are not generally caught by professional fisherman in large enough volume for pallet lots, so the number of suppliers become limited and there is little availability.
Shore Catch is offering a service where you can pre-order storm garfish and we will supply when they become available. We are currently keeping a list of customers on a “first in first served” basis and you just need to contact us to be added to the list. There is no guarantee of exactly when we will be able to supply but we will communicate with you about your order.
All fish are purchased market fresh, graded, vacuum sealed (100 micron bags) and snap frozen. They are currently in 2 size classes – XL (3-5 fish per kg) and L (6-8 fish per kg), which are packed in 1kg lots and price is $25. If stored appropriately the packs will last for a few years.

Fishing licence fees to increase from july 8
Submitted by meglodon on Wed, 2017-06-28 22:35Did every body see the big announcement about the fishing licence fees to increase by $5.00 as from July 8.
No
Well you would have to have looked hard to find the notification about the increase in all fees, it was hidden away towards the back of my local news paper this brings up the cost of each licence to $45.00 and a fishing from boat licence to $35.00.
This is the first increase in 7 years so I guess that's not to bad.
I think it's just a shame that this increase wasn't given a more prominent place in the paper and I haven't seen anything in the West Australian news paper about the increase. I don't have a gripe against the rise, 7 years without an increase isn't doing to bad I think.
